commit c4cfb20f2c867f30eb10611e974974937dabf77a
Author: David Malcolm <dmalcolm at redhat.com>
Date:   Wed Jun 22 14:57:53 2011 -0400

    reorganize test exclusions (test_openpty and test_pty seem to be failing on every arch, not just the explicitly-listed ones)

 python.spec |   85 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++---------
 1 files changed, 72 insertions(+), 13 deletions(-)
